Fathoms and meters are both units used to measure length, with the fathom being more commonly used in nautical contexts. Understanding their relationship is useful in various fields.
The conversion between fathoms and meters relies on a fixed ratio. One fathom is defined as exactly 1.8288 meters. This conversion factor is crucial for any calculation between the two units. This definition is based on the international fathom.
There is no difference in conversion between base 10 (decimal) and base 2 (binary) for fathom to meter, as it's a direct unit conversion.
To convert 1 fathom to meters, simply multiply by the conversion factor:
Therefore, 1 fathom is equal to 1.8288 meters.
To convert 1 meter to fathoms, divide by the conversion factor:
So, 1 meter is approximately equal to 0.5468 fathoms.
The term "fathom" comes from the Old English word "fæthm," which means the length of the outstretched arms. Historically, it was used extensively in maritime activities to measure the depth of water.
Sailors use fathoms to quickly estimate water depth to avoid running aground. If a sailor measures a depth of 5 fathoms, this equals 9.144 meters.

Fathoms are a unit of length primarily used for measuring water depth. Understanding its origin and applications provides valuable context for maritime and historical studies.
A fathom is a unit of length equal to six feet (approximately 1.8288 meters). It's primarily used in maritime contexts to measure the depth of water. The symbol for fathom is fm.
The term "fathom" originates from the Old English word "fæthm," which meant the distance between the fingertips of two outstretched arms. This roughly corresponds to six feet. Historically, it was a practical way for sailors to measure depth before sophisticated instruments were available.
The length of a fathom is based on the average span of a man's outstretched arms. While not precisely defined by any single individual's measurement, it represents a practical approximation.

Meters are fundamental for measuring length, and understanding its origins and applications is key.
The meter () is the base unit of length in the International System of Units (SI). It's used to measure distances, heights, widths, and depths in a vast array of applications.
The meter is defined based on the speed of light in a vacuum, which is exactly 299,792,458 meters per second. Therefore, 1 meter is the distance light travels in a vacuum in seconds.
The meter is the base unit of length in the metric system, which is a decimal system of measurement. This means that larger and smaller units are defined as powers of 10 of the meter:
The metric system's simplicity and scalability have led to its adoption by almost all countries in the world. The International Bureau of Weights and Measures (BIPM) is the international organization responsible for maintaining the SI.
